NVIDIA and Acer Laboratories Inc. (ALi) announced today the Aladdin TNT2 integrated graphics chipset for the sub-$1000 PC market. The Aladdin TNT2 merges ALi’s proven Slot 1/Socket 370 Northbridge design and NVIDIA’s award-winning RIVA TNT2 3D graphics core into a single integrated chip.
